Browse Source

调整快速测试模式下的细节,无关发布版本

Signed-off-by: allan716 <[email protected]>
allan716 3 years ago
parent
commit
0dd05b4f75

+ 2 - 1
cmd/chinesesubfinder/main.go

@@ -118,9 +118,10 @@ func main() {
 		common.SetApiToken("")
 	}
 	// 是否开启开发模式,跳过某些流程
-	settings.GetSettings().SpeedDevMode = false
+	settings.GetSettings().SpeedDevMode = true
 	if settings.GetSettings().SpeedDevMode == true {
 		loggerBase.Infoln("Speed Dev Mode is On")
+		pkg.SetLiteMode(true)
 	} else {
 		loggerBase.Infoln("Speed Dev Mode is Off")
 	}

+ 4 - 2
pkg/downloader/downloader.go

@@ -5,13 +5,14 @@ import (
 	"fmt"
 	"sync"
 
+	"github.com/allanpk716/ChineseSubFinder/pkg/logic/sub_supplier/assrt"
+
 	"github.com/allanpk716/ChineseSubFinder/pkg/ifaces"
 	embyHelper "github.com/allanpk716/ChineseSubFinder/pkg/logic/emby_helper"
 	"github.com/allanpk716/ChineseSubFinder/pkg/logic/file_downloader"
 	markSystem "github.com/allanpk716/ChineseSubFinder/pkg/logic/mark_system"
 	"github.com/allanpk716/ChineseSubFinder/pkg/logic/pre_download_process"
 	subSupplier "github.com/allanpk716/ChineseSubFinder/pkg/logic/sub_supplier"
-	"github.com/allanpk716/ChineseSubFinder/pkg/logic/sub_supplier/csf"
 	"github.com/allanpk716/ChineseSubFinder/pkg/logic/sub_timeline_fixer"
 	common2 "github.com/allanpk716/ChineseSubFinder/pkg/types/common"
 
@@ -132,7 +133,8 @@ func (d *Downloader) SupplierCheck() {
 
 	if d.settings.SpeedDevMode == true {
 		// 这里是调试使用的,指定了只用一个字幕源
-		subSupplierHub := subSupplier.NewSubSupplierHub(csf.NewSupplier(d.fileDownloader))
+		//subSupplierHub := subSupplier.NewSubSupplierHub(csf.NewSupplier(d.fileDownloader))
+		subSupplierHub := subSupplier.NewSubSupplierHub(assrt.NewSupplier(d.fileDownloader))
 		d.subSupplierHub = subSupplierHub
 	} else {
 

+ 2 - 1
pkg/logic/pre_download_process/pre_download_proces.go

@@ -102,7 +102,8 @@ func (p *PreDownloadProcess) Init() *PreDownloadProcess {
 	if p.settings.SpeedDevMode == true {
 
 		p.SubSupplierHub = subSupplier.NewSubSupplierHub(
-			csf.NewSupplier(p.fileDownloader),
+			//csf.NewSupplier(p.fileDownloader),
+			assrt.NewSupplier(p.fileDownloader),
 		)
 	} else {